Fear is a very powerful emotion and it can have a strong effect on your body and mind. Fear can create a lot of strong response signals when our brain senses an emergency situation. For example, if you saw something catch fire your fight, flight, or freezer response would kick in. However, it’s not uncommon to feel anxious when you start a new job, go on a date, or take an exam.

Anxiety can often last for a short period of time. However, anxiety attacks can last a lot longer. In some cases, you might even feel stuck in a cycle of anxiety. This can affect your ability to sleep, travel, concentrate, eat, and even go shopping, go to work, or school. Anxiety can take hold of people and cause them to avoid all of those things that make them anxious. This can be the case even if it’s detrimental to their health.

Anxiety can feel quite frightening. It could cause you to:

  • Have a faster heartbeat
  • Have muscles that feel quite weak
  • Breath more quickly
  • Feel dizzy
  • Have a dry mouth
  • Sweat a lot
  • Feel very tense
  • Feel frozen to the spot
  • Find it hard to think about anything else

You may experience some or all of the above symptoms when you’re feeling anxious. This is because these symptoms are your body’s natural response to emergencies.

How Therapy Can Help Managing Anxiety

If you’re in Pennsylvania or Delaware and want virtual therapy, we can help you. We can use a range of therapies to ensure that you feel much safer when you’re having an anxiety attack. We will also help you to identify and challenge your negative thoughts. We do this so that you can work on replacing these thoughts with kinder, more realistic thoughts.

We might even ask you to expose yourself to anxiety-provoking situations. While being anxious is not pleasant, repeated exposure could help you. Through the exposure, you can become desensitized to those situations that make you feel anxious.

Our anxiety therapy can help you to deal with your anxious thoughts and feelings in a safe, secure, and constructive way.
